--- name: agent-backend:create-mutation description: Generate Convex mutations with 6-dimension ontology validation, event logging, and organization scoping --- # Agent-Backend: Create Mutation ## Purpose Generate production-ready Convex mutations that: - Validate authentication and organization context - Implement 6-dimension ontology operations (things, connections, events) - Log events for audit trails - Enforce organization quotas - Handle errors with meaningful messages ## When to Use This Skill - Implementing new mutation handlers - Creating CRUD operations for entities - Building state-change operations - Enforcing multi-tenant isolation - Adding event logging ## Instructions ### 1. Map to 6 Dimensions Identify what dimensions the mutation affects: ```typescript // Example: Creating a course (mutation affects multiple dimensions) // 3. THINGS: Create course entity // 4. CONNECTIONS: Create owns relationship // 5. EVENTS: Log course_created event ``` ### 2. Use Standard Mutation Pattern ```typescript export const create = mutation({ args: { name: v.string(), properties: v.any(), }, handler: async (ctx, args) => { // 1. AUTHENTICATE const identity = await ctx.auth.getUserIdentity(); if (!identity) throw new Error("Not authenticated"); // 2. GET ACTOR (person/creator) const person = await ctx.db.query("things") .withIndex("by_type_and_email", q => q.eq("type", "user") .eq("properties.email", identity.email) ) .first(); if (!person) throw new Error("User not found"); // 3. VALIDATE ORGANIZATION const org = await ctx.db.get(person.groupId); if (!org || org.status !== "active") { throw new Error("Organization invalid or inactive"); } // 4. CHECK QUOTAS if (org.properties.usage.things >= org.properties.limits.things) { throw new Error("Entity limit reached for this plan"); } // 5. CREATE ENTITY (Dimension 3: Things) const entityId = await ctx.db.insert("entities", { groupId: person.groupId, type: args.type, // e.g., "course", "product" name: args.name, properties: args.properties, status: "draft", createdAt: Date.now(), updatedAt: Date.now(), }); // 6. CREATE OWNERSHIP CONNECTION (Dimension 4: Connections) await ctx.db.insert("connections", { groupId: person.groupId, fromEntityId: person._id, toEntityId: entityId, relationshipType: "owns", metadata: { createdVia: "api" }, validFrom: Date.now(), createdAt: Date.now(), }); // 7. LOG EVENT (Dimension 5: Events) await ctx.db.insert("events", { groupId: person.groupId, type: `thing_created`, actorId: person._id, targetId: entityId, timestamp: Date.now(), metadata: { thingType: args.type, source: "api", }, }); // 8. UPDATE ORGANIZATION USAGE await ctx.db.patch(org._id, { properties: { ...org.properties, usage: { ...org.properties.usage, things: (org.properties.usage?.things || 0) + 1, }, }, updatedAt: Date.now(), }); return entityId; }, }); ``` ### 3. Validation Patterns ```typescript // Type validation export function validateEntityType(type: string): string { const validTypes = THING_TYPES; // From ontology if (!validTypes.includes(type)) { throw new Error(`Invalid type. Must be one of: ${validTypes.join(", ")}`); } return type; } // Permission validation export function validatePermission(person, org, requiredRole) { const role = person.properties.role; const allowedRoles = ROLE_HIERARCHY[requiredRole] || []; if (!allowedRoles.includes(role)) { throw new Error(`Permission denied. Required role: ${requiredRole}`); } } // Organization scoping function validateOrgContext(person, org) { if (!person.groupId || person.groupId !== org._id) { throw new Error("Organization mismatch"); } if (org.status === "suspended") { throw new Error("Organization suspended"); } } ``` ### 4. Event Logging Pattern Every state change must log an event: ```typescript // ALWAYS log after mutations await ctx.db.insert("events", { groupId: person.groupId, type: "thing_created", // Use specific event types actorId: person._id, // Who did it targetId: entityId, // What was affected timestamp: Date.now(), metadata: { // Include context for audit trail entityType: args.type, properties: args.properties, source: "api", userAgent: ctx.request?.headers.get("user-agent"), }, }); ``` ### 5. Error Handling ```typescript try { // Mutation logic const entityId = await ctx.db.insert("entities", { /* ... */ }); return entityId; } catch (error) { // Log errors for debugging console.error("Mutation failed:", { handler: "create", actor: person._id, organization: org._id, error: error.message, }); // Return meaningful error if (error.message.includes("Limit reached")) { throw new Error("You've reached your plan limit. Upgrade to create more."); } throw error; } ``` ## Critical Rules 1. **ALWAYS authenticate** - Every mutation starts with `ctx.auth.getUserIdentity()` 2. **ALWAYS validate organization** - Check organization status and existence 3. **ALWAYS check quotas** - Enforce plan limits before operations 4. **ALWAYS log events** - Every state change creates an event 5. **ALWAYS scope by groupId** - Multi-tenant isolation is mandatory 6. **ALWAYS use indexes** - Query with `withIndex()` for performance ## Example: Creating a Course ```typescript export const create = mutation({ args: { name: v.string(), description: v.optional(v.string()), modules: v.optional(v.array(v.object({ title: v.string(), duration: v.number(), }))), }, handler: async (ctx, args) => { // 1. Authenticate const identity = await ctx.auth.getUserIdentity(); if (!identity) throw new Error("Not authenticated"); // 2. Get creator (person) const creator = await ctx.db.query("things") .withIndex("by_type_and_email", q => q.eq("type", "user") .eq("properties.email", identity.email) ) .first(); if (!creator) throw new Error("Creator not found"); // 3. Validate organization const org = await ctx.db.get(creator.groupId); if (!org || org.status !== "active") { throw new Error("Organization invalid"); } // 4. Check quota if (org.properties.usage.courses >= org.properties.limits.courses) { throw new Error("Course limit reached"); } // 5. Create course entity const courseId = await ctx.db.insert("entities", { groupId: creator.groupId, type: "course", name: args.name, properties: { description: args.description, modules: args.modules || [], authorId: creator._id, createdByAPI: true, }, status: "draft", createdAt: Date.now(), updatedAt: Date.now(), }); // 6. Create ownership connection await ctx.db.insert("connections", { groupId: creator.groupId, fromEntityId: creator._id, toEntityId: courseId, relationshipType: "owns", metadata: { role: "author" }, validFrom: Date.now(), createdAt: Date.now(), }); // 7. Log event await ctx.db.insert("events", { groupId: creator.groupId, type: "course_created", actorId: creator._id, targetId: courseId, timestamp: Date.now(), metadata: { courseName: args.name, moduleCount: args.modules?.length || 0, }, }); // 8. Update usage await ctx.db.patch(org._id, { properties: { ...org.properties, usage: { ...org.properties.usage, courses: (org.properties.usage?.courses || 0) + 1, }, }, updatedAt: Date.now(), }); return courseId; }, }); ``` ## Related Skills - `agent-backend:create-query` - Complementary skill for reading data - `agent-backend:design-schema` - Schema design for entities - `agent-backend:validate-types` - TypeScript type generation ## Related Documentation - [6-Dimension Ontology](../../../one/knowledge/ontology.md) - [Backend Agent](../agents/agent-backend.md) - [Convex Mutation Patterns](https://docs.convex.dev/functions/mutations) ## Version History - **1.0.0** (2025-10-27): Initial implementation with 6-dimension mapping
